Signed By: Digital Communications Inc.
Status: Valid

The signature on SegurazoEngine.dll is reported as valid. A valid signature helps confirm publisher identity, but it does not automatically make the file safe if the installer was bundled, abused, or downloaded from an untrusted source.

%commonappdata%\segurazo
%programfiles%
%sysdrive%\$recycle.bin\s-1-5-21-3839523217-1552131579-2165781140-1000

ThreatInfo has observed SegurazoEngine.dll in the locations listed above. Files found in temporary folders, user profile folders, startup locations, or unusual application directories should be reviewed more carefully than files installed under a known program directory.

SegurazoEngine.dll is identified as pe for 32-bit systems. The subsystem is Windows GUI. PE header values are useful for triage, especially when they do not match the expected publisher, product, or release timeline.

Format pe
Architecture 32-bit
Subsystem Windows GUI
Entry point 0x00021c67
Image base 0x10000000

PE Sections:

Sections 7
Raw data 3363840

Section layout highlights raw-size concentration, repeated names, packer markers, and hashes that can be compared across related samples.

.text 647168 bytes · 19.2% of section data
MD5 301a2ed1d8fc674252137081cdcfd2f5
.rdata 103936 bytes · 3.1% of section data
MD5 ac90fd32d79ece393325a7775445dc1c
.data 2593280 bytes · 77.1% of section data
MD5 e617633fa5f25c4e26e896c5bc65dbc3
.gfids 512 bytes · 0.0% of section data
Uncommon name
MD5 2da2cc13182c826f6859071c8e2aa60c
.tls 512 bytes · 0.0% of section data
MD5 1f354d76203061bfdd5a53dae48d5435
.rsrc 1536 bytes · 0.0% of section data
MD5 d90fbcf4e99f59f2002fe08c36af4351
.reloc 16896 bytes · 0.5% of section data
MD5 ca1fb93d4587d80aef1ac845dfddce08

PE section names and hashes can reveal packing, injected resources, or unusual build artifacts. Sections with uncommon names, very large raw data, or hashes that differ from a trusted copy deserve additional review.
